Immutable Price Drops Amid Weak Momentum but Sees Long-Term Potential
Immutable (IMX), a blockchain infrastructure project for NFTs and Web3 gaming, has seen its price drop along with the broader NFT and gaming sector. At the time of writing, IMX is trading around $0.1178.
The token's price has fallen after breaking below its recent swing low of $0.11242, giving sellers stronger control and pushing the token into a fresh downtrend. Technical indicators also point to weak momentum, with the 7-day RSI falling to 29.85, placing IMX in the oversold zone.
However, Immutable's infrastructure role could help IMX move higher as gaming adoption increases. The project is focused on growing its zkEVM gaming network and making Web3 games easier for regular players to use. Its Immutable Passport is also being expanded to make it easier for gamers to manage their accounts, assets, and progress across different games.
